The UManage Center for the Science of Symptom Self- Management pre sents the above talk by Dr. Portia Singh, Senior Research Scientist at Philips Research North America. Dr. Singh will share her experiences using technology in the aging domain in three different sectors -academia, government, and industry.She will then focus in on industry researchand the work being done by her team on the topic of understanding technology needs for informal caregiversproviding assistance to chronically ill or frail elder loved ones.

Dr. Singh holds a PhD in Biomedical Engineering from Carnegie Mellon University and a BS in Computer Science from Grambling State University. Prior to joining Philips, she served as a Hardy-Apfel IT Fellow with the Social Security Administration under President Obama’s Administration.   She is an active member of the National Society of Black Engineers National and local chapters, contributing to the Society’s mission to increase the number of underrepresented minorities in STEM fields.
